What type of visa do you need?

The type of visa required for a Malaysian trip depends on the purpose of your visit and the duration of your stay. Generally, there are four types of visas available for Malaysian visitors:

Single-entry visa

Multiple-entry visa

Transit visa

Long-term visa

A single-entry visa allows visitors to enter Malaysia once and stay for a specific period of time before the visa expires. A multiple-entry visa allows visitors to enter and exit Malaysia multiple times during the valid period. A transit visa allows a brief stopover in Malaysia while the visitor is en route to another destination. Long-term visas are for individuals who are planning to live in Malaysia for an extended period of time for work or study purposes.

Documents Required

Regardless of what type of visa you need, every Malaysian visa application requires a set of basic documents. These documents include:

Passport (with at least 6 months validity from the date of travel)

Two recent passport-size photos

Visa application form

Flight itinerary (showing round trip)

Proof of accommodation in Malaysia

Proof of financial capacity (bank statement for the past three months)

Letter of invitation (if applicable)

Additional documents may be required depending on the type of visa required. For instance, a work visa may require a letter from the employer, while a student visa may require proof of enrollment in a Malaysian educational institution.

Application Process

Malaysia visa application can be made online or in person at a Malaysian embassy or consulate. The online application process is the most convenient and popular way. Here are the steps to apply for a Malaysia visa online:

Visit the official website of the Malaysia Visa Application Center.

Fill in the online visa application form.

Upload all the required documents and pay the visa fee.

After the application has been processed, take a printout of the visa approval letter.

Upon arrival in Malaysia, present the visa approval letter at the airport to get your passport stamped.

The visa processing time varies depending on the type of visa applied for and the embassy or consulate handling the application. It is important to apply for your visa at least one month prior to your travel date.
